Transaction 1d150c89955c81acfb27cf811ba51767a93193beee1601226eeda78216786434
1 Input
1 Output
-
1d150c89955c81acfb27cf811ba51767a93193beee1601226eeda78216786434:0
- value
- 1531825
- script pubkey
- OP_0 OP_PUSHBYTES_20 df1b4924ae491633f481e9b364aa12fbb1eda360
- address
- bc1qmud5jf9wfytr8aypaxekf2sjlwc7mgmqpc4ufu